форкнуто от main/python-labs
main
Родитель
3bbde25280
Сommit
a80996500c
@ -0,0 +1,27 @@
|
|||||||
|
# Индивидуальное контрольное задание по теме 4
|
||||||
|
|
||||||
|
Ефремов Станислав, А-02-23
|
||||||
|
|
||||||
|
## Задание
|
||||||
|
Вариант - 9
|
||||||
|
Напишите инструкцию, позволяющую определить и записать в переменную календарные характеристики (год, месяц, день) момента, отстоящего на 7000000 сек. вперед от текущего времени. Выведите эти сведения в виде строки вида: «Это будет ХХ-ХХ-ХХХХ». Создайте множество с 5 случайными целыми элементами, значения которых находятся в диапазоне значений от 1 до 12.
|
||||||
|
|
||||||
|
## Решение
|
||||||
|
|
||||||
|
```py
|
||||||
|
>>> name = 'Иван'
|
||||||
|
>>> surname = 'Иванов'
|
||||||
|
```
|
||||||
|
|
||||||
|
Создать требуемую переменную `full_name` можно так:
|
||||||
|
|
||||||
|
```py
|
||||||
|
>>> fut = time.gmtime(time.time()+3*3600+7000000)
|
||||||
|
>>> fut
|
||||||
|
time.struct_time(tm_year=2026, tm_mon=1, tm_mday=9, tm_hour=12, tm_min=5, tm_sec=34, tm_wday=4, tm_yday=9, tm_isdst=0)
|
||||||
|
>>> print(f'Это будет {fut.tm_mday}-{fut.tm_mon}-{fut.tm_year}' )
|
||||||
|
Это будет 9-1-2026
|
||||||
|
>>> mn = set(random.sample(range(1,13),5))
|
||||||
|
>>> print(mn)
|
||||||
|
{1, 2, 3, 5, 12}
|
||||||
|
```
|
||||||
Загрузка…
Ссылка в новой задаче